How to Choose the Perfect Virginia B&B for You
With so many options, picking the right B&B can feel overwhelming. Here are some tips to help you find the perfect fit:
Consider Your Priorities: Are you looking for a romantic getaway, a quiet retreat, or a venue for a small event? Knowing what you want helps narrow your choices.
Check Reviews: Look for places with glowing guest feedback about cleanliness, hospitality, and atmosphere.
Look for Amenities: Some B&Bs offer extras like hot tubs, fireplaces, or farm tours. Decide which features matter most to you.
Location Matters: Choose a spot that’s convenient for your travel plans but still offers that peaceful escape.
Ask About Meals: Breakfast is a highlight, so find out what’s included and if they can accommodate dietary needs.
Taking a little time to research will ensure your stay is exactly what you hoped for.
